A bronze statue of Eliza Roxey Snow is installed in front of the Pioneer Memorial Museum in Salt Lake City, Utah.[1] The artwork commemorates pioneer women.[2] The statue was sculpted by Mormon artist Ortho Rollin Fairbanks in 1952.[3]
